ECL86 (6GW8) Vacuum Tube: The Complete Guide for Hi-Fi Builders

Feb 19, 2026 | 0 comments posted by Vincent Zhang

Published by IWISTAO

The ECL86 is one of the most practical all-in-one audio tubes ever designed. It integrates a triode voltage amplifier and a power pentode output stage within a single glass envelope, enabling compact, efficient, and musically engaging tube amplifier designs.

Known in the U.S. as 6GW8, the ECL86 became widely used in European hi-fi systems, console amplifiers, and DIY audio projects thanks to its elegant circuit simplicity and warm sonic character.


1. Tube Structure and Functional Role

  • Triode Section — Used for input gain and voltage amplification.
  • Pentode Section — Drives the output transformer and loudspeaker load.

This dual-section architecture allows a complete amplifier channel to be built using only one tube, reducing component count while maintaining excellent tonal coherence.

ECL86 circuit diagram

 


2. Equivalent and Related Tubes

  • 6GW8 — Direct equivalent (plug-compatible).
  • PCL86 — Similar internal structure but different heater voltage (~13.3V). Not directly interchangeable.

3. Key Electrical Specifications

Parameter Typical Value
Heater Voltage 6.3V
Heater Current ~0.76A
Triode Gain (μ) ~70
Pentode Plate Dissipation ~9W
B+ Operating Range 250–300V DC
Single-Ended Output 3–4W
Push-Pull Output 8–10W

4. Amplifier Topologies

Single-Ended (SE)

  • One ECL86 per channel
  • Simple signal path
  • Warm midrange, ideal for high-efficiency speakers

Push-Pull (PP)

  • Two tubes per channel
  • Higher power output
  • Improved bass control and headroom
ECL86 Push-Pull (PP)

 


5. Output Transformer Matching

Topology Primary Impedance
Single-Ended 5kΩ – 7kΩ
Push-Pull 8kΩ – 10kΩ CT

A properly matched output transformer ensures optimal power transfer, low distortion, and extended bandwidth performance.


6. Power Transformer Requirements

High-Voltage Secondary

  • 250-0-250V to 275-0-275V AC
  • Produces ~250–300V DC after rectification

Current Capacity

  • SE Stereo: ≥120mA
  • PP Stereo: ≥180mA

Heater Winding

  • 6.3V / 0.76A per tube
  • SE Stereo recommended: 6.3V / 3A
  • With preamp tubes: 6.3V / 4A

7. Rectification Options

  • Solid-State Diodes — Higher efficiency, lower cost.
  • Tube Rectifiers (EZ81 / 6CA4) — Softer voltage ramp, vintage character.

8. Power Supply Filtering

Common filter networks:

  • CRC — Capacitor → Resistor → Capacitor
  • CLC — Capacitor → Choke → Capacitor

Typical values:

  • First capacitor: 47–100µF
  • Second capacitor: 100–220µF
  • Choke: 5–10H / ≥100mA

9. Transformer Core Type Selection

  • EI Core — Traditional, stable, widely used.
  • R-Core — Lower stray field, premium builds.
  • Toroidal — Compact but sensitive to DC mains offset.

10. Sonic Characteristics

  • Warm, rich midrange
  • Smooth treble
  • Moderate output drive
  • Excellent vocal presentation

Recommended Transformers for ECL86 Builds

Category Recommended Specification Application Notes
Output Transformer (SE) 5kΩ – 7kΩ Primary
4Ω / 8Ω Secondary
≥40mA DC rating
Optimized for single-ended ECL86 amplifiers delivering ~3–4W output.
Output Transformer (PP) 8kΩ – 10kΩ CT Primary
4Ω / 8Ω Secondary
Used in push-pull stereo amplifiers for higher power and headroom.
Power Transformer (SE Stereo) 250-0-250V / 120mA
6.3V / 3A Heater
Standard supply for two-tube stereo single-ended builds.
Power Transformer (PP Stereo) 275-0-275V / 180mA
6.3V / 4A Heater
Supports push-pull output stages with greater current demand.
Choke (Filter Inductor) 5–10H
≥100mA current rating
Used in CLC filtering to reduce ripple and improve bass authority.

Conclusion

The ECL86 remains one of the most elegant solutions in compact tube amplifier design. With proper transformer matching, robust power supply engineering, and quality passive components, it delivers a refined and musically engaging listening experience far beyond its modest power rating.

For DIY builders and boutique hi-fi manufacturers alike, ECL86 offers the perfect balance between engineering simplicity and sonic artistry.
